Chameera to replace Prasad

Published February 10, 2015

COLOMBO: Sri Lanka on Monday nominated Dushmantha Chameera as replacement for the injured Dhammika Prasad at the upcoming World Cup.

The 23 year-old fast bowler has represented Sri Lanka in only one one-day match, taking two wickets.

Prasad was ruled out of the World Cup last Saturday because of a fractured hand, an injury he sustained when he attempted a return catch at practice.

Chameera’s inclusion is subject to approval by the International Cricket Council technical committee, Sri Lanka Cricket said in a statement.

Sri Lanka faces New Zealand in the tournament opener on Saturday (Feb 14).
